About Excellent Vision
Excellent Vision is a Beijing-headquartered spatial AI company transforming video feeds into 4D world models for large language models. The platform enables spatial reasoning, object tracking, and scene generation using Gaussian splatting and neural radiance fields technologies. Excellent Vision serves applications in robotics and autonomous driving across Asia.

Excellent Vision Funding History
Excellent Vision has raised a total of $550M across 6 funding rounds.
Excellent Vision's first fundraising round was a $7M seed round in September 2024. The most recent completed round was a $148M Series B in June 2026.

| Jun 2026 | Series B | Shenzhen Guozhong Venture Capital Management; Wanxiang Qianchao; Huacang Capital; Jin Venture Capital; JIC Investment; Dyee Capital; Huagai Capital; Fortune Venture Capital; Yuanshi Fund; Fosun RZ Capital; China-Belgium Fund; Turing Asset Management | $148M | Beijing-based startup GigaAI secured CNY 1.0 billion (~USD 139 million) in Series B2 financing on June 15, 2026, with a reported enterprise valuation exceeding CNY 10.0 billion (~USD 1.39 billion+). The round was led by Jiantou Huawen Investment, Wanxiang Qianchao Company, Huagai Venture Capital, and Jiangsu Youcheng Jinchuang Investment Management, alongside Singapore's Lion Partners Capital, China-Belgium Direct Equity Investment Fund, CICC Investment, Fosun RZ Capital, Deyi Capital, Huacang Capital, and Yuanshi Fund. Existing shareholders Guozhong Capital, Fortune Capital, and Turing Asset Management substantially increased their holdings. This B2 round is part of a broader CNY 3.5 billion (~USD 518 million) fundraising spree across three rounds (Pre-B, B1, B2) completed in just three months. GigaAI is allocating proceeds to develop data and algorithm systems, refine its AGI foundation model, and scale robot products for household and industrial settings. The company is a global leader in Physical AGI, developing spatial intelligence and world model platforms for embodied AI and general-purpose robotics. ChinaVest Capital served as the financial advisor for this round and the company's exclusive long-term consultant. The fundraising attracted market subscription interest far exceeding the initial target, underscoring strong investor confidence in physical AGI and general-purpose robots in China's physical AI sector, which accounted for 43% of global robotics venture investment in Q1 2026. |
